Ocala Christian extended their winning streak to four on Friday, bumping them up to 4-2. They strolled past the First Coast Christian Knights with points to spare, taking the game 38-22. That result was just more of the same for these two, as the Crusaders also won the last time the pair played back in October of 2024.

Joshua Davis continued his habit of posting crazy stat lines, rushing for 256 yards and three touchdowns while picking up 11.1 yards per carry, and also throwing for 27 yards and one TD. Those 256 rushing yards gave him a new career-high. Another rusher making a difference was Troy Wade, who rushed for 100 yards and one score.
They were just one part of a punishing run game: Ocala Christian was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 410 rushing yards.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now rushed for at least 215 rushing yards in 13 consecutive matchups dating back to last season.
Having lost for the first time this season, First Coast Christian fell to 3-1. The loss was their first of the season.
When it comes to explaining why First Coast Christian lost, don't look at Bernard Young. Despite the final result, he rushed for 149 yards and one TD on only seven carries. Young really tore up the turf during one magnificent 75-yard run.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Ocala Christian will challenge First Academy at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. The Eagles' defense has only allowed 12.4 points per game this season, so the Crusaders' offense will have their work cut out for them. As for First Coast Christian, they will square off against Countryside Christian at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.
